
Rijeka, Croatia based Doom Metal band Old Night unveil the first single and music video “Cognitive Dissonance” taken from their third full-length album “Ghost Light,” set to release on March 4, 2022 via Solitude Productions. Watch the video through the YouTube player below:
The band comments: “We are proud to present you the first video from our new record Ghost Light. Cognitive Dissonance is a song about everything that transpired in Croatia since it’s indipendance. We would like to thank our director Kristina Barišić for a wonderful job as always, but also everyone else that worked on and behind the scenes.
With a little delay we are pleased that we can anounce the presale of our third record Ghost Light as well as the release of new merchandise. Hope you’ll enjoy it.”

Old Night was formed in 2015 by Luka Petrović, best known as the lyricist and one of the main composers of Ashes You Leave. The band originally started as a solo project. The main idea behind this band was to make innovative and original music, completely unencumbered by other people’s expectations, but with the legacy of Ashes You Leave intact. Although Old Night is mainly a doom metal band, the music itself is highly influenced by Progressive Rock, Blues and Atmospheric music in general.
